Tracker device contract

by Mark Rowe

Securi-Guard Monitoring Services has a contract with True-Kare, to provide round the clock monitoring for UK users of its GPS Tracker device.

Designed for use by ‘at risk’ groups such as lone workers, vulnerable adults, children and those with serious medical conditions, the tracker will be monitored at Plymouth-based Securi-Guard’s National Security Inspectorate (NSI) Gold BS 8484 Lone Worker Monitoring Centre.

The monitoring services will be provided for the clients of True-Kare’s UK suppliers and distributors – and Securi-Guard will also be able to sell the GPS Tracker devices to its own customers, through True-Kare.

Pete Stanley, Head of Telematics at Securi-Guard Monitoring Services, said: “We have built up very strong partnerships with manufacturers, suppliers and distributors around the world, who are at the forefront of lone worker devices and True-Kare are very much part of that select group. Increasingly, clients are seeing the high standards we set for monitoring excellence and recognise we have the necessary infrastructure and expertise in place to deliver a service we firmly believe is second to none.”

Based in Portugal, True-Kare offers ‘assisted living solutions’ for use by care providers to improve the safety, as well as quality of life, for those in their care.

The GPS Tracker is one of a number of electronic products True-Kare offers that enable users to be tracked by Global Positioning Satellite (GPS) in the event of an emergency. As well as ‘live’ GPS location the device will also give a history of previous locations. Small for discreet concealment in clothing, the device also features an in-built SOS button, so users can raise the alarm if they are in immediate need of help.
